Hardware requirements

  • Mini/Micro USB cable

  • FRDM-K32L2A4S board

  • Voltmeter

  • Personal Computer

Board settings

To measure the DAC output, connect J4-11 to positive of Voltmeter

Prepare the Demo

  1. Connect a USB cable between the PC host and the OpenSDA USB port on the board.

  2. Open a serial terminal on PC for OpenSDA serial device with these settings:

    • 115200 baud rate

    • 8 data bits

    • No parity

    • One stop bit

    • No flow control

  3. Download the program to the target board.

  4. Either press the reset button on your board or launch the debugger in your IDE to begin running the demo.

  5. A multimeter may be used to measure the DAC output voltage.

Running the demo

When the demo runs successfully, the log would be seen on the OpenSDA terminal like:

DAC basic Example.
Please input a value (0 - 4095) to output with DAC: 200
Input value is 200
DAC out: 200

Then user can measure the DAC output pin to check responding voltage.
